We investigate CP-violating phenomena both in semi-inclusive and exclusive penguin-induced B-meson decays by using low energy effective Hamiltonians for \DELTAB\ = 1, DELTAC = DELTAU = 0 transitions including leading and next-to-leading order QCD corrections. In particular, we discuss the renormalization scheme dependences arising beyond the leading order and their explicit cancellation for the physical transition amplitudes. In order to estimate the hadronic matrix elements needed for the exclusive penguin modes, we apply both the Bauer, Stech, Wirbel model and the meson model of Brodsky and Lepage. Numerical results are presented for semi-inclusive b-->q'qqBAR (q', q is-an-element-of {d, s}) modes and the exclusive decays B--->K-K0, B--->pi-K0BAR, and B(d)0-->K0K0BAR.
